Round other answers to 2 decimal places. 2) A researcher records response times to a normally distributed tactile stimulus that has a mean response time of 22 milliseconds with a standard deviation of 2.8 milliseconds. What is the probability that a sample of 45 participants responded with an average of less than 21.5 milliseconds? Write a sentence explaining what your answer means, 3) The lifetime of a certain lightbulb is normally distributed with a mean of 1460.7 hours and a standard deviation of 81.48 hours. What is the probability that a lightbulb chosen at random from this group would last more than 1400 hours? Write a sentence explaining what your answer means.

The print on the package of 100-watt General Electric soft-white light-bulbs says that these bulbs have an average life of 750 hours. Assume that the lives of all such bulbs have a normal distribution with a mean of 750 hours and a standard deviation of 55 hours. Find the probability that the mean life of a random sample of 25 such bulbs will be a. greater than 725 hours. Round your answer to four decimal places. Enter you answer in accordance to the item a) of the question statement . b. between 735 and 740 hours. Round your answer to four decimal places. Enter you answer in accordance to the item b) of the question statement . c. within 10 hours of the population mean. Round your answer to four decimal places. Enter you answer in accordance to the item c) of the question statement . d. less than the population mean by at least 25 hours or more. Round your answer to four decimal places.
